I'd heard the same thing over the years, but according to their new advertisement, these have receivers that are actually made in the U.S. Perhaps that is a change.
http://www.gunsamerica.com/blog/century-international-arms-c39-sporter-rifle-ammo-shortage-low-ammo-prices-low-gun-prices-100-american-made/ wrote:Century International closed the loop a couple years ago and started manufacturing completely new US-made AK-47s dubbed the C39 Rifle. The receivers of the Century International Arms guns are machined from solid steel for better accuracy and repeatability. The rest of the parts are pretty standard AK parts.

Every time we post a story or video mentioning either the AK-pattern rifle or the 7.62×39 cartridge we get Internet gun experts popping up to tell us that AKs simply aren’t accurate, aren’t designed to get hits beyond 100 yards, etc.

This is typically an indication of one of three things.

- The person making the comment has never actually fired an AK.
- The person making the comment has only shot a lower-end, poor quality AK made by drunken monkeys.
- The person making the comment simply can’t shoot, but prefers to blame the rifle instead of admitting he needs to spend a weekend at an Appleseed event learning the basics.

In this video, Rob Ski of AKOU 47-74 goes to work with an AK at 300 yards, which is well within the range of the platform and the 7.62×39 cartridge. A good shooter can take a correctly manufactured 7.62×39 AK past 350-400 yards, and a 5.45×39 another 100 yards beyond that.
